[0028] The research and utilization of sacrificial materials has always been a matter of great concern in the retention strategy of molten materials. For example, the water-soluble and alkaline borate mentioned in the patent US-Pat4300983, whether the filler is heated and melted or melted with the oxide melt, the high-density metal melt will sink to the bottom of the molten pool, and the oxide will float. Based on the structure of the upper layer; for example, the patent US-Pat5410577 adopts alternately arranging multiple layers of glass material and lead material layers, and uses the characteristics of low glass density and high lead density as the later heat insulation layer.
